About ECDA Formation

The Eggon Cultural and Development Association (ECDA) was formed to unify all Eggon people, preserve cultural identity, and promote sustainable development across all communities.

Our Formation

ECDA was established as a central coordinating body for all Eggon people, both at home and in the diaspora. It serves as a platform for unity, dialogue, cultural preservation, and development initiatives.

Our Objectives

Fostering Unity

To bring all Eggon people together under one strong umbrella for progress and peace.

Cultural Preservation

To preserve language, traditions, and cultural heritage for future generations.

Community Development

To promote education, infrastructure, healthcare, and social welfare initiatives.

Global Representation

To represent Eggon interests nationally and internationally through structured leadership.
